Korg Triton Extreme "Star Wars United" Sampler & Sequence Synthesizer Demo
Published on Jul 27, 2015 SynthgodXXX
All sounds Korg Triton Extreme: "Korg Triton Extreme in sequencer mode recording the sample triggers by key in real time. I had Multi-Tap Delay for insert effects. Everything done within the Triton Extreme & re-sampled the song as a .WAV to the Compact Flash card."
